I assumed this meant the icon displayed in the launcher/home screen/app switcher (a.k.a. the one we define in our android manifest).
From all I have seen it is not possible to dynamically change the app icon that is shown in the launcher (ignoring app updates). Inside the app (in action bars and such) we can obviously show whatever icon we want - but making all these changes can be expensive. Unfortunately there's no Android resource qualifier for "restricted profile".
